Job description

Role overview

The Branch Manager for Gold Loans is responsible for running the branch end to end, with accountability for business growth, profitability, customer experience, portfolio health, compliance, and operational discipline. The role oversees customer acquisition, loan processing and disbursement, collections, cross-sell, risk controls, and the supervision of valuation activities through the Manager Valuation and Officer Valuation roles.

Business context

This position sits within the Financial Services business unit of Aditya Birla Capital Limited and supports gold loan operations across branches in India. The role is critical in a competitive market where quick turnaround, customer trust, accurate operations, and strong portfolio quality directly affect business performance.

Key responsibilities

Own overall branch performance and ensure targets are met across disbursement, portfolio growth, revenue, and profitability. Build the branch business through local market development, lead generation, customer acquisition, and relationship management with customers, influencers, and channel partners. Deliver strong customer service, retention, and grievance resolution.

Manage the full gold loan process, including documentation, valuation oversight, secure handling of pledged gold, underwriting checks, and timely disbursement in line with approved policies. Track LTV compliance, portfolio movements, renewals, delinquencies, overdue accounts, and recovery actions. Support auction readiness and collections effectiveness as required by policy.

Ensure strict compliance with company SOPs, regulatory norms, audit controls, and risk guidelines. Keep the branch prepared for internal and external audits and act quickly on any portfolio or process deviation. Strengthen controls to reduce fraud, prevent spurious gold issues, and avoid policy breaches.

Lead, coach, monitor, and develop the branch team, including Manager Valuation, Officer Valuation, and branch sales/operations staff where applicable. Improve productivity, sales effectiveness, people capability, and cross-sell of other financial products.

Major challenges

The role requires balancing growth with portfolio quality, keeping the branch profitable and productive, maintaining zero tolerance for operational or valuation lapses, preventing fraud and fake gold risks, sustaining service quality during high transaction volumes, and managing collections efficiently while building a strong team.

Direct report responsibilities

The Manager Valuation is expected to perform accurate gold purity testing and valuation, handle pledged ornaments safely, assess risk, support loan disbursement and customer acquisition, and follow valuation SOPs closely.

The Officer Valuation is responsible for conducting gold testing and valuation, maintaining records, ensuring secure handling of ornaments, and supporting branch operations according to established procedures.

Relationship management

The role interacts regularly with the Area Head / Regional Head for business reviews, target tracking, portfolio updates, and escalations. It also works with the Risk & Audit team for compliance and audit closure, the Operations team for transaction approvals and process support, HR for staffing and performance matters, customers for business and service needs, local influencers and channel partners for market development, and security vendors and facilities teams for asset protection and branch infrastructure.

Qualifications and experience

A graduate in any discipline is required, with an MBA preferred. The ideal candidate will bring 5 to 10 years of experience in gold loans, retail lending, NBFCs, banking, or financial services, along with a proven background in branch management, business development, portfolio management, and team leadership.

Core competencies

The position calls for strong business development and sales management capability, leadership and people development skills, portfolio and collections management expertise, a solid understanding of risk and compliance, customer relationship management, process excellence, decision-making ability, market awareness, and negotiation skills.

Reporting structure

The Branch Manager reports to the Area Business Head / Area Head, with responsibility for the performance of the branch and direct oversight of valuation and branch support teams where applicable.
